Output 5d8ba905a8f61cfa131f841da8c47ce43e33f65af88f1ca22ccb0687f1854352:2

value
216949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fbffb6c6c5d8104c7a42097174c20ec66d0e5e OP_EQUAL
address
3DdbefsccgugDty9icbPJxXCXN6rMdnxx3
transaction
5d8ba905a8f61cfa131f841da8c47ce43e33f65af88f1ca22ccb0687f1854352
spent
true